BlackBerry Bold 9000
General Description
This global messaging smartphone from Blackberry is designed with
the international traveler in mind, with quad-band GSM and tri-band
3G connectivity as well as Wi-Fi connectivity.
Since business people already love and trust the Blackberry for
its easy to use navigation, reliable call service and productivity
features, this new addition to the range is sure to please.
Style, comfort and functionality blend together well with this
smartphone. It is comfy to hold and the soft pleather backing means
it stays snugly in place on those slippery hot, humid days. If you
don't like the look, it's easy enough to peel off. This is certainly
the Bold and Beautiful rival with a huge screen and fantastic resolution.
Form Factor
- Size: 4.5 x 2.6 x 0.6 inches ; 4.8 ounces - that's much larger
than the 8310 and close to the 8800 series.
- Screen - with a resolution of 480x320 [that's twice the resolution
of the Curve at. 320x240].
- Weight: 1.4 lbs
Key Features
- Bluetooth for handsfree devices
- MicroSD expansion to a whopping 32 GB
- USB cable
- 3.5mm stereo headset
- 3G connectivity - at last!!
- Variable screen lighting - responds to ambient light by becoming
brighter when it's bright, and dimmer with backlit keyboad in
low light. A really cool feature.
- Very loud speaker for music playback with surprising quality.
- Voice dialing works surprisingly well - try downloading vLingo
to make it even better!
Media & Apps
- AT&T Mobile Music, and streaming video from Cellular Video
service
- Compatible with AT&T Navigator GPS turn-by-turn directions
- a real bonus for the top smartphones today
- 2-megapixel camera/camcorder
- Compatiable with Google mobile apps and Yahoo - try downloading
the new blackberry versions of gmail and google maps.
- Pushes email from GMAIL with minimal setup - something the Apple
iPhone sadly lacks.
Power
Up to 4.5 hours of talk time, up to 324 hours (13.5 days) of standby
time. The battery drains pretty fast when downloading content over
3G but is pretty much on par with other 3G phones.
Plug it in for charging and it automatically switches to a clock
display mode, to easily set the alarm, making it perfect for your
main alarm system.

Overall
The Blackberry Bold seems to have taken the best of previous Blackerrys,
and then some. The web broswer is a much needed improvement over
past models and whilst it doesn't handle media on screen as well
as the iPhone, the productivity suite support [such as Mail] make
it a better choice for the business man.
